Shortwave radio
Shortwave radio
Radio transmission using radio frequencies in the shortwave bands
Definition
Radio transmission using frequencies in the shortwave bands (SW), typically in the 3 to 30 MHz range, which extends from the high frequency band (HF) to just above the medium frequency band (MF) and to the bottom of the VHF band.
Propagation
Utilizes skywave or 'skip' propagation, allowing radio waves to be reflected or refracted from the ionosphere back to Earth at great distances, beyond the visual horizon.
Historical Significance
Played a crucial role in early radio history and was used as a propaganda tool during World War II. Its peak as an international broadcasting medium occurred during the Cold War, between 1960 and 1980.
The Kalman filter is a powerful algorithm used extensively for estimating the state of a linear dynamic system from a series of incomplete and noisy measurements. It is particularly effective in applications where precise and optimal estimation is crucial, such as in signal processing, control systems, and more recently, in object tracking and navigation systems.

Comparison with Other Methods

1. Recursive vs. Non-Recursive Methods

The Kalman filter is a recursive estimator, meaning it processes measurements as they arrive, one at a time. This is in contrast to non-recursive methods, which require access to all data for processing. The recursive nature of the Kalman filter makes it particularly suitable for real-time applications in shortwave communications, where signals are continuously received and must be processed in real-time124.

2. Handling of Noise and Uncertainty

The Kalman filter is designed to optimally estimate the states of a linear dynamic system in the presence of noise. This makes it highly effective in shortwave communications, where the signal can be significantly affected by atmospheric conditions, ionospheric disturbances, and other forms of interference. Other methods may not handle noise as effectively, especially if they assume a static model or lack robust mechanisms to update their estimates based on new measurements124.

3. Efficiency in Linear and Gaussian Environments

While the Kalman filter is optimal for linear systems with Gaussian noise, other filters like the Particle filter are better suited for non-linear and/or non-Gaussian environments. However, for the linear and Gaussian scenarios typical in many shortwave communication models, the Kalman filter is more efficient because it avoids the computational complexity of simulation methods used by Particle filters2.

4. Computational Complexity

The Kalman filter generally offers lower computational complexity compared to methods like the Particle filter, which uses a sequential Monte Carlo method involving potentially thousands of simulations. This makes the Kalman filter more practical for real-time applications in shortwave communications, where computational resources and power may be limited2.

5. Adaptability and Flexibility

The Kalman filter can adapt to changes in the system dynamics through its update equations, which continuously refine the estimates based on new data. This adaptability is crucial in shortwave communications, where channel characteristics can change rapidly. Other methods might require reconfiguration or recalibration to adapt to such changes, which can be impractical in real-time operations124.

Several methods are used for shortwave channel sequence detection, each with its unique approach and application scenarios. Here are some of the notable methods:

1. Spectral Subtraction

This method involves subtracting an estimate of the noise spectrum from the spectrum of the noisy signal. It is commonly used for denoising shortwave time service signals and can effectively reduce noise components, thereby improving the clarity and detectability of the signal5.

2. Short-Time Energy Detection

This technique detects signals based on changes in energy within short time frames. It is useful in environments where signal strength varies, allowing for the detection of signal presence or absence over brief periods5.

3. Spectral Entropy Method

Spectral entropy measures the randomness or uncertainty in the signal's spectral power distribution. This method can be used to analyze the complexity of a shortwave signal, helping in distinguishing between different types of signals or detecting anomalies5.

4. Blind Detection Method

This approach does not rely on prior knowledge of the channel state information. It typically uses energy detection but can be challenging in effectively detecting shortwave communication signals due to the lack of channel state information6.

5. Improved DFT-Based Channel Estimation

This method enhances the Discrete Fourier Transform (DFT)-based channel estimation techniques. It is particularly useful in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iplexing (OFDM) systems for shortwave communications, improving the accuracy of channel estimates and the overall system performance7.

6. Open-Set Recognition Based on Dual-Input

This method involves the use of dual-input models for open-set recognition in blind shortwave signal processing. It addresses the challenge of recognizing signal types that are not predefined in the system, enhancing the flexibility and adaptability of shortwave signal processing systems8. Each of these methods offers different advantages and may be preferred based on specific requirements such as the need for real-time processing, the level of noise in the environment, and the availability of prior information about the channel or signal characteristics.

Limitations and Comparisons

  1. Complexity in Non-Linear Systems: While the Kalman filter excels in linear systems, its performance can be suboptimal in non-linear systems unless modifications like the Extended Kalman Filter (EKF) or the Unscented Kalman Filter (UKF) are used. These variants, however, introduce additional computational complexity47.
  2. Dependency on Accurate Noise Covariance Estimation: The performance of the Kalman filter heavily relies on the accurate estimation of the process and measurement noise covariances. Misestimation of these parameters can lead to suboptimal performance. Techniques such as adaptive filtering are sometimes necessary to maintain performance in varying conditions1.
  3. Comparison with Particle Filters: Particle filters, which are better suited for non-linear and non-Gaussian environments, can offer more robust performance in such conditions compared to the standard Kalman filter. However, particle filters typically require more computational resources, which can be a drawback in resource-constrained environments4.
  4. Performance in Diverse Conditions: Studies comparing different forms of Kalman filters (like ESKF and DSKF) and other techniques (like loop-bandwidth control algorithms) in shortwave applications show that while Kalman filters are generally effective, their performance can vary significantly based on the specific implementation and the system characteristics. For instance, loop-bandwidth control algorithms have shown superior performance in some settings due to their simpler implementation and effective handling of specific types of noise and dynamics1.
